Bug 14776: Remove 'selfcheck' patron related links from and add language selector to SCO header
The SCO screen displays patron related menu items in it's header (Link to the account and "Logout"). This makes no sense since the patron that is logged in is the 'selfcheck' user as defined in syspref AutoSelfCheckId. Additionally, the language menue is missing when the syspref OpacLangSelectorMode is set to 'top' or to 'both'. To test: - Apply on top of Bug 15039 - Set AutoSelfCheck sysprefs as appropriate - Set OpacLangSelectorMode to 'top' or 'both' - Go to SCO page - Verify that the language menue does not display in the header - Enter a card number to check out (this logs in the SCO user) - Verify that you get text similar to "Welcome, checkout" with a link to the sco user's account in the OPAC and a 'Logout' link - Apply patch - Verify that the language menu appears and the SCO user's information disappears. - Verify, that the language menu displays / does not display with combinations of: - opaclanguagedisplay (Allow) - opaclanguages ( > 1 language selected) - OpacLangSelectorMode (top or both) Signed-off-by: Jonathan Druart <jonathan.druart@bugs.koha-community.org> Signed-off-by: Tomas Cohen Arazi <tomascohen@theke.io>
This commit is contained in:
parent
21d17e490d
commit
b02619928b
1 changed files with 5 additions and 5 deletions
|
@ -1,3 +1,5 @@
|
|||
[% USE Koha %]
|
||||
[% SET OpacLangSelectorMode = Koha.Preference('OpacLangSelectorMode') %]
|
||||
<div id="wrap">
|
||||
<div class="navbar navbar-inverse navbar-static-top">
|
||||
<div class="navbar-inner">
|
||||
|
@ -9,15 +11,13 @@
|
|||
</ul>
|
||||
</div>
|
||||
|
||||
[% IF ( validuser ) %]
|
||||
[% IF ( opaclanguagesdisplay ) %]
|
||||
<div id="members">
|
||||
<ul class="nav pull-right">
|
||||
<li><p class="members navbar-text">Welcome, <a href="/cgi-bin/koha/opac-user.pl"><span class="loggedinusername">[% FOREACH USER_INF IN USER_INFO %][% USER_INF.title %] [% USER_INF.firstname %] [% USER_INF.surname %][% END %]</span></a></p></li>
|
||||
<li class="divider-vertical"></li>
|
||||
<li><p class="navbar-text">[% IF persona %]<a class="logout" id="logout" href="/cgi-bin/koha/opac-main.pl?logout.x=1" onclick='navigator.id.logout();'>[% ELSE %]<a class="logout" id="logout" href="/cgi-bin/koha/opac-main.pl?logout.x=1">[% END %]Log out</a></p></li>
|
||||
[% INCLUDE 'masthead-langmenu.inc' %]
|
||||
</ul>
|
||||
</div> <!-- /members -->
|
||||
[% END # / IF validuser %]
|
||||
[% END # / IF opaclanguagedisplay %]
|
||||
|
||||
</div> <!-- /container-fluid -->
|
||||
</div> <!-- /navbar-inner -->
|
||||
|
|
Loading…
Reference in a new issue